In 1887 two Giggleswick teachers walked the Giggleswick to Giggleswick Three Peaks walk. Paul Clark and Bill Bartlett followed in their footsteps in September 2010 taking on Ingleborough on Friday evening and then, after an overnight stop near Station Inn Ribblehead, they did Whernside and Penygent before getting back to Giggleswick at 7pm on Saturday. About 16 hours walking. You can take on the challenge yourself by signing up to the walk at Giggleswick school in May each year.
